The bare minimum a distributed system developer should know about: networking

10/31/2017 1:21:39 PM

At the TCP level, we deal with IP and ports. For simplicity's sake, I'm going to ignore IPv4 vs. IPv6, because they don't matter that much at this level (except that they do, but we'll get to that later). This means that we need to have some way to translate "my-awesome-service" into an IP address.